56" Stanley Upright
#9904
Walnut Cabinet. Built in 1904 by the Stanley Piano Company,
Toronto, Canada. Reconditioned, regulated and tuned by Ray’s Piano
Service, January 2004
This was a premier quality Canadian-built piano
when new. Still in excellent playing condition without additional
improvements. Has almost new bass strings. We decided to complete a
minimum of repairs and to resell the piano for a "bargain"
price.
IMPROVEMENTS
COMPLETED:
Recondition
action—Clean. Reshape hammers, tighten screws, replace
additional defective parts.
Complete
Regulation—All adjustments to ensure that piano plays like
new. Tune to A-440
Repair
Cabinet—Clean. Tighten cabinet screws. Repair cabinet as
needed. Install new rubber buttons. This piano was nicely refinished
by a previous owner.
Bench--New matching
walnut bench included.
